![]() To learn more, read Passwordless Connections Best Practices. If you enable this setting, you can allow passwordless access for only existing users, but may expose your application to the threat of user enumeration attacks. Otherwise, an attacker has a larger window of time to attempt to guess a short code.ĭecide if you want to Disable Sign Ups. If you choose to extend the amount of time it takes for your one-time password to expire, you should also extend the length of the one-time password code. The one-time password issued will be valid (by default) for three minutes before it expires. After this, a new code will need to be requested. Learn how to use 1Password to store and quickly access your one-time passwords when you turn on two-step verification for a website. Only three failed attempts to input the one-time password are allowed. Use 1Password as an authenticator for sites with two-factor authentication. In this case, we have only used numbers from 0 to 9. They are generally combination of 4 or 6 numeric digits or a 6. Step 3: In the OTPGenerator class, create a method named generateOTP. Now a days OTP’s are used in almost every service like Internet Banking, online transactions, etc. Create the API routes, helpers, service, and handlers With the models to send and verify OTP fully set up, we need to navigate to the api folder and do the following: First, we need to create a route. Once used, the latest one is also invalidated. Python Program to generate one-time password (OTP) One-time Passwords (OTP) is a password that is valid for only one login session or transaction in a computer or a digital device. Once the latest one is issued, any others are invalidated. It means after migrating, a table will be created which your application needs to store verification tokens. Only the last one-time password (or link) issued will be accepted. Note that Laravel OTP package uses the already configured cache driver to storage token, if you have not configured one yet or have not planned to do it you can use database instead. The placeholder will automatically be replaced with the one-time password that is sent to the user.Īdjust settings for your OTP Expiry and OTP Length.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|